Abstract

This study aims to determine the actualization of the value of global diversity in the behavior of grade IV students at SD Negeri 34 Parit Madura. The research method used is a calytic method with a descriptive approach. The data collection technique in this study uses observation and documentation techniques. Data analysis was carried out qualitatively consisting of data reduction, data presentation, and conclusion drawing. The results of this study show that grade IV students of SD Negeri 34 Parit Madura show positive results in various aspects of diversity attitudes. The attitude of knowing and appreciating other cultures obtained an average of 80%, indicating that most students are able to appreciate and accept cultural, religious, and ethnic diversity. Intercultural communication skills are also excellent with an average of 88%, reflecting students' skills in interacting effectively with various cultural backgrounds. Openness and tolerance reached an average of 79%, indicating students' readiness to learn from different perspectives and adjust to a multicultural environment. Finally, attitudes of reflection and responsibility towards diversity experiences reached an average of 87%, indicating students' understanding of human rights and rejection of discrimination. Overall, students showed a strong and positive attitude in applying the value of diversity

Abstract

The schedule of prayer is very important akan ada.Masa Today many in the mosque as well as in homes that usually have a calendar and the viewer time of eternal prayer, but it looks so small that it can not be seen from a great distance. This prayer timepiece uses a display display dot matrix P4, displaying the date, digital clock as well as the 5th time of the prayer. So that prayer times can be changed in real time according to time and day changes, and can be seen from a great distance and can be used to maximize the time available. This research produces a digital clock time system that uses dot-matrix as display, RTC as real time clock, bluetooth as sender of data from smart mobile device android, and buzzer as alarm. So that the system formed the digital clock time of this prayer. Based on design, implementation and testing, the arduino-based digital time-shaped design tool can be used for digital clocks and bookmarks and prayer time reminders.
